Last weekend I drove to Qingyuan Julong Bay to soak in hot springs. The hotel I stayed in was great. I would like to share my experience with you. 🏡Environment: There is construction around the hotel, but it is very close to Julongwan Hot Spring and can be reached on foot. After soaking in the hot springs during the day, you can also go to the nearby night market to eat. The night market is full of delicious food, and all kinds of snacks are gathered together. There are crispy and delicious fried foods and steaming special soups. Everything can satisfy the taste buds and make people linger. 🏨Equipment: The hotel's internal facilities are brand new. The room is neat and clean, the bathroom is well separated from wet and dry, and the mirror is rotatable and has soft lighting, making it easy to organize makeup. The electric curtains operate smoothly and adjust the light easily. In addition, the hotel also provides delicious snacks for you to eat in your spare time, which will make you feel full of happiness. There are hot spring pools on the top floor and the first floor below. The price is affordable, only 58 yuan per pool. 🌉Transportation: The transportation is convenient when driving from Guangzhou, the roads are in good condition, and you can reach it quickly. The hotel has a parking lot, which is convenient and you don't have to worry about parking your car. The hotel owner's service is also very considerate. If you have any questions, you can get enthusiastic responses and solutions in a timely manner. Overall, this trip to Qingyuan Julong Bay was very enjoyable. Both the hotel facilities and surrounding facilities are very suitable for a relaxing weekend vacation. I recommend it to everyone!

Environment: Just what I wanted, a natural rural landscape. There's also a small scenic spot called Broken Bridge nearby, where many people camp. Service: Excellent. The owner even took us sightseeing in a shuttle bus. In the evenings, there's a bonfire party in the square outside the reception area where you can sing and have a barbecue (sold). The atmosphere is much better with more people. Facilities: Overall, quite good. The bed faces the window with a view of a bamboo forest. The morning sunlight streaming through the bamboo is very pleasant. The room is a one-bedroom apartment with two bathrooms, but the hot tub leaked, making water all over the bathroom floor. The owner needs to fix it. Dining: Breakfast is a 3-minute drive from Yaowang Valley Hotel, not far. It's a buffet, not a huge selection, but they do have rice noodle rolls, which is quite nice. Dinner options nearby are limited unless you drive out, where there are other options within about 10 minutes.
